Southborough School Committee Backs 3.99 Percent FY27 Budget Increase

SOUTHBOROUGH — January 22, 2026 — Southborough School Committee approves 3.99 percent FY27 budget increase ahead of cross-board review. The committee voted 4-0 at a special January 22 meeting to support the revised recommended operational budget, incorporating late adjustments including a reduction in applied Circuit Breaker reimbursement from $500,000 to $300,000, restoration of facilities accounts, the addition of a 42nd instructional section placed in grade three, and a reduction in at least one out-of-district tuition. The superintendent described it as "a level services budget" with "some compromises." The capital plan, voted the prior week, consolidates security upgrades ($1.4 million across four schools), technology improvements ($360,000), and the Trottier Middle School roof replacement — estimated at just under $8.9 million gross, with a projected 41 percent MSBA reimbursement — all into FY27, with an April town meeting vote required on the full gross amount.
